Transaction 3e52d7ccc8dadc51572e448796c59d07194e98b59e9ef5159720e9a32cd35e0c

block
da7ed5994be8bc42d393209f0df068aaefe41fd61c6e515f88871bbcd29e6299

1 Input

23 Outputs